Gmail to come up with more chat icons for Google chat and spaces for Android

Gmail launching chat iconsGmail for Android is getting a new update that will replace the status bar icons for alerts from Google’s Chat and Spaces services. With Google Hangouts approaching its end of life, this is a new feature that further differentiates the two chat systems. Chat is the company’s primary messaging software, while Spaces is a Slack-like rival for chatting with bigger groups. Before this update, both the icons for the chat and spaces looked the same. Each would display you a message bubble filled in with an empty one behind it. That is no longer the case, and chat will henceforth display only an empty single message bubble.

Whatsapp brings multi-device updates to all the web and desktop users

WhatsApp has released a multi-device update with bug fixes and other upgrades. It is being given out to WhatsApp users on the desktop and the web. The multi-device beta upgrade allows users to connect four desktop PCs at once without the requirement for a phone with an active internet connection. Because it was a beta, anyone may opt-in and out at any moment, according to WABetaInfo. The update will soon be available for Android and iOS users as well.

WhatsApp rolls out multi-device feature, details inside

0

Social messaging app WhatsApp has rolled out multi –device feature for its users. According to the latest update, users will now be able to use WhatsApp on Web, Desktop, and other devices by linking them to their phone. They can use up to four linked devices and one phone at a time.

It is worth to note here that user’s phone is not needed to stay online while using WhatsApp on linked devices. According to WhatsApp, linked devices will become disconnected if users will not use their phone for more than two weeks. To use WhatsApp multi-device feature, it is a must to register their WhatsApp account and link new devices with their phone.

The newly introduced changes and more improvements is expected to be rolled out by WhatsApp to all iOS users by the end of this month and Android users in next month.

How to use WhatsApp on other devices

Open WhatsApp on your phone and click on three dots on upper right corner

Click on linked devices and select ‘Link A Device’. You can use upto four devices without keeping your phone online.

Steps for Android users

Open WhatsApp on your phone.

Tap More options > Linked devices.

Tap LINK A DEVICE.

Unlock your phone.

Follow the on-screen instructions, if your device has biometric authentication.

You will be prompted to enter the pin you use to unlock your phone, if you don’t have biometric authentication enabled device.

To scan the QR code you need to point your phone at the screen of the device you want to link.

How to link an iPhone

Open WhatsApp and go to WhatsApp Settings.

Tap Linked Devices and select ‘Link a Device’.

Unlock your phone if you are on iOS 14 or above:

Use Touch ID or Face ID to unlock.

You will be prompted to enter the pin you use to unlock your phone, If you don’t have biometric authentication enabled device.

To scan the QR code you need to point your phone at the screen of the device you want to link.

Privacy

WhatsApp will take care of your privacy. Personal messages, media, and calls will continue to be end-to-end encrypted.

Unsupported features

You cannot clear or delete chats on linked devices if your primary device is an iPhone. You will not be able to message or call someone who is using very old version of WhatsApp on their phone. You cannot view live locations on linked devices and create and view broadcast lists on linked devices. Additionally, sending messages with link previews from WhatsApp Web is currently not being supported.

Google reaches Africa, the browsing speed is about to get high!

0

According to Google, an undersea cable that would increase internet speeds for millions of Africans landed in Togo on Friday, March 18, 2022, the latest phase in a multi-year initiative to bring cheaper access to customers throughout the continent. Reportedly, the Equiano cable, which is the first of its type to reach Africa, has twisted its way from Portugal and will increase internet speed for Togo’s 8 million citizens.

Togo is going to be the first one to reap the benefits. According to a Google-commissioned study by Africa Practice and Genesis Analytics, the cable is predicted to lower internet rates by 14% by 2025. Availability in other African continents

The new route will also reach Nigeria, Namibia, and South Africa, with future extensions connecting to more nations in the region. It is also expected to be operational by the end of the year. For other nations poised to profit in a region where internet use is rapidly increasing, but networks are frequently cripplingly sluggish and a drag on economic progress, this might be a taste of things to come.

According to a 2020 analysis by GSMA Intelligence, Sub-Saharan Africa remains the world’s least-connected area, with approximately a quarter of the population still missing mobile broadband service, compared to 7% globally. Furthermore, the majority of West African nations rank towards the bottom of a global rating of internet penetration by the World Bank.

Russians got banned while Ukrainians received more free features on PayPal

0

PayPal is expanding its services for Ukrainian users and waiving fees to aid humanitarian efforts in the country as Russia continues to invade the country. Ukrainians will be able to make and receive peer-to-peer PayPal or Xoom payments, according to a press release, and the company will not charge any fees on either side of the transaction.

Previously, people in Ukraine could only utilise the payments platform to send money out of the country. They will now be able to receive funds and conduct transfers both within and outside of Ukraine. Customers in Ukraine will be able to transfer money from their PayPal Wallet to their bank account by linking an appropriate Mastercard or Visa debit or credit card.

PayPal

PayPal also announced that Ukrainians will be able to transfer funds from their accounts to Mastercard and Visa cards. Also, citizens who have fled the country will be able to use these features provided they open a PayPal account in Ukraine. According to the company, Ukrainians will be able to send and receive funds in US and Canadian dollars, as well as British pounds and Euros. (The hryvnia is Ukraine’s official currency.)

PayPal’s announcement comes in response to a request from the Ukrainian government for the payments company to roll out new services that would allow Ukrainians to obtain payment access.

Ukraine’s Vice Prime Minister and Minister of Digital Transformation, Mykhailo Fedorov, praised the expansion on Twitter and shared a letter he received from PayPal with the public.

“Our teams have worked intensively to recognize how PayPal could quickly provide additional services to Ukrainians,” the letter from PayPal said. “We believe this service will be helpful for Ukraine people to accept money from their relatives and friends around the world. Also, it will help Ukrainian refugees in other countries, so they can receive funds to withdraw or use in their current location.”

Customers in Ukraine will be able to send and receive funds in USD, CAD, GBP, and EUR using their Ukrainian PayPal Wallet. The money will be available in the currency associated with that card after a consumer transfers funds from their PayPal Wallet to an approved debit or credit card.

PayPal’s services were shut off in Russia earlier this month, prompting the announcement. PayPal isn’t the only corporation to abandon Russia; Mastercard and Visa have both discontinued network services in the country.

Since the war began, people have been looking for methods to financially support Ukrainians. According to Airbnb CEO Brian Chesky, some people from around the world have been booking Airbnbs in Ukraine without intending to stay there, in order to send financial help to hosts in the country. Additionally, Ukraine has received cryptocurrency donations worth tens of millions of dollars from people who are looking to help its war effort against Russia.

The expanded services of PayPal will simplify a more direct way to support Ukrainians.

Why Factory Reset?

Factory Reset can return your Android device to the state it was in when it was first designed. This means that any installed programmes, apps, software, passwords, accounts, games, and other personal data saved on your phone’s internal memory will be erased.

As a result, you should be aware that a factory reset will destroy all of your phone’s data, necessitating the backup of your contacts, photos, videos, documents, and anything else you don’t want to lose. The leftover items are ones pre-installed settings by the manufacturer and downloaded data in the SD card. Any programmes on the card, on the other hand, will have to be reloaded or restored from a backup file.

Portronics launches portable wireless conference speaker ‘Talk One’

0

The lack of adequate devices can occasionally throw a spanner in the works when it comes to online meetings or video conferencing, which has become the new office environment today. Choosing a good conference speaker can make things run more smoothly and vividly. So, with Portronics Talk One, a highly portable wireless conference speaker, you can turn your online meetings into something as real as a face-to-face discussions in seconds.

Talk One uses some of the most cutting-edge technologies to ensure that you get the greatest audio and voice clarity over any online application you use. The device is incredibly small, allowing you to start a virtual meeting whenever and wherever you need it without having to worry about space or efficiency. The Portronics Talk One is compatible with multiple applications for conferencing that include Google, Apple, Hangouts, Skye, and many others.

The Portronics Talk One, which is about the size of a wireless charging pad, contains three omnidirectional microphones that help with enhanced 360° voice pickup from up to 5 metres away for glitch-free meetings. The three microphones also help to eliminate background noises, similar to how ANC (Active Noise Cancellation) mode works. A high-end speaker driver is also on board, delivering superb audio quality so your online guest or team member may be heard clearly.

The Portronics Talk One may be linked as a wireless speaker system for your smartphone, tablet, or laptop, or simply use the Aux-input for desktop PCs, thanks to its best-in-class audio processor and Bluetooth v5.1 technology. The speaker comprises all the essential buttons to function your meetings or music at the touch of your finger. Make and receive calls, control the volume, quickly mute or skip your audio tracks with a single control panel on the device.

Lastly, the Portronics Talk One is equipped with a 2,600mAh internal rechargeable battery that lets you to conduct meetings or listen to music for up to 10 hours on a single charge. You can quickly recharge the battery via the USB-C port, ensuring that you don’t miss any online appointments. A pass-through USB port is also present, allowing you to connect another USB device to your computer.
